代码地址: https://gitee.com/zjj19941/MybatisGenerated
在idea中集成了MyBatis Generator的功能,下面介绍需要怎么使用这个插件。
1、在pom.xml文件的build节点加上以下代码
<plugin><groupId>org.mybatis.generator</groupId><artifactId>mybatis-generator-maven-plugin</artifactId><version>1.3.5</version><configuration><configurationFile>src/main/resources/generatorConfig.xml</configurationFile><overwrite>true</overwrite><verbose>true</verbose></configuration></plugin>
2、在resources目录下新建generatorConfig.xml文件,内容如下:
<?xml version="1.0" encoding="UTF-8"?><!DOCTYPE generatorConfigurationPUBLIC "-//mybatis.org//DTD MyBatis Generator Configuration 1.0//EN""http://mybatis.org/dtd/mybatis-generator-config_1_0.dtd"><generatorConfiguration><classPathEntry location="C:\splanchnic\maven\mvnRespo\mysql\mysql-connector-java\5.1.44\mysql-connector-java-5.1.44.jar" /><context id="testTables" targetRuntime="MyBatis3"><commentGenerator><property name="suppressAllComments" value="true" /></commentGenerator><jdbcConnection driverClass="com.mysql.jdbc.Driver"connectionURL="jdbc:mysql://localhost:3306/angus_oa"userId="root"password="123456"></jdbcConnection><javaTypeResolver><property name="forceBigDecimals" value="false" /></javaTypeResolver><javaModelGenerator targetPackage="com.angus.entity"targetProject="src/main/java"><property name="enableSubPackages" value="false" /><property name="trimStrings" value="true" /></javaModelGenerator><sqlMapGenerator targetPackage="main.resources.mapping"targetProject="src"><property name="enableSubPackages" value="false" /></sqlMapGenerator><javaClientGenerator type="XMLMAPPER"targetPackage="com.angus.dao"targetProject="src/main/java"><property name="enableSubPackages" value="false" /></javaClientGenerator><table tableName="t_user" domainObjectName="User"enableCountByExample="false" enableUpdateByExample="false"enableDeleteByExample="false" enableSelectByExample="false"selectByExampleQueryId="false"></table></context></generatorConfiguration>
注意修改 这块儿的配置信息,修改成自己的账号密码
userId=”root”
password=”123456”>
3、加入maven配置,在Command line中加入mybatis-generator:generate -e,效果如下:

mybatis-generator:generate -e
4、最后,启动项目即可

